Senegalese and Gambians are one and the same people. No difference, the same ethnic group, the same language, the same culture, also the same religion. Infact, for 7 years in the 80's, Senegal and Gambia were one country, Senegambia. The push-ups was just a sign of respect and loyalty to the incoming President, not the Senegalese.


The Senegalese are not also a hostile force, Senegal, Nigeria and Ghana only entered the country when the Gambian President gave them the green light to do so.

Dude, you were in support of a military action right from the start. Also, you're forgetting a tiny winny bit, Nigeria = ECOWAS.

We always make up 70% of all ECOWAS deployment. Now, despite our issues with Boko-Haram, we have troops in Mali, Guniea, Liberia, now Gambia. We also have Naval assets in Benin and Sao-Tome. That's just ECOWAS, not all of Africa.
